Heat Pump Pros and Cons

heat pump pros and cons

As an increasing number of homeowners seek efficient and sustainable heating and cooling solutions, heat pumps have emerged as a popular choice. These versatile systems offer both heating and cooling capabilities, but like any technology, they come with their own set of advantages and disadvantages. In this article, we'll delve into heat pump pros and cons to help you make informed decisions about whether they are the right choice for your home when you are considering AC replacement.

Heat Pump Pros

Energy Efficiency: Heat pumps are highly energy-efficient, especially in moderate climates. They can provide both heating and cooling, often using less energy than traditional heating and cooling systems. They can deliver more heat energy than the electricity they consume, resulting in significant energy savings.

Year-Round Comfort: Heat pumps offer versatile heating and cooling capabilities, making them suitable for year-round comfort. They can efficiently heat your home in winter and cool it in summer, eliminating the need for separate heating and cooling systems.

Environmentally Friendly: Heat pumps produce fewer greenhouse gas emissions compared to fossil fuel-based heating systems, making them environmentally friendly options for reducing carbon footprints.

Lower Operating Costs: With their high efficiency, heat pumps can help lower energy bills, especially in regions with moderate climates. They can provide significant cost savings over time compared to traditional heating and cooling systems.

Safety: Heat pumps do not involve combustion, eliminating the risk of carbon monoxide poisoning or other safety hazards associated with gas furnaces.

Long Lifespan: When properly maintained, heat pumps can have a long lifespan, typically lasting 15-20 years or more. This longevity provides homeowners with reliable heating and cooling for many years.

Zoned Heating and Cooling: Ductless mini-split heat pumps offer zoned heating and cooling, allowing you to control temperatures in individual rooms or zones for personalized comfort and energy savings.

Cons:

Upfront Cost: Heat pumps can have higher upfront costs compared to traditional heating and cooling systems, especially for high-efficiency models or ductless mini-split systems.

Temperature Limitations: While heat pumps can effectively heat homes in moderate climates, their efficiency may decrease in extremely cold temperatures. In such cases, supplemental heating may be required to maintain comfort.

Installation Requirements: Proper installation is crucial for the performance and efficiency of heat pumps. Ducted systems require professional installation with careful consideration of ductwork design, while ductless mini-split systems may require multiple indoor units for optimal coverage.

Noise: Some heat pump models may produce noise during operation, particularly outdoor units. However, advancements in technology have led to quieter heat pump models available on the market.

Potential for Ice Buildup: In cold climates, heat pumps may experience ice buildup on the outdoor unit during defrost cycles. While this is a normal part of operation, it can temporarily reduce efficiency until the ice melts.

Dependence on Electricity: Heat pumps rely on electricity to operate, which may be a concern in areas with unreliable power supply or during power outages. However, backup generators or battery backups can mitigate this issue.
